Windsor police have charged three Windsor residents with several drug offences following a sting operation.
Police say they were arrested on Monday afternoon during a stakeout. The primary suspect was taken into custody after a brief foot pursuit in the area of Milloy St. and Westcott Rd. Officers then stopped a vehicle associated to the suspect a short distance away and found a package containing a quantity of drugs. Two more suspects were arrested and the following items were seized;
- 8.3 grams of suspected cocaine
- 26.8 grams of suspected methamphetamine
- 1.7 grams of suspected fentanyl
- 3.4 grams of suspected heroin
- eight Percocet tablets
A 23-year-old man and a 27-year-old man are charged with several drug trafficking-related charges. A 37-year-old woman is also charged with a number of drug trafficking-related charges. All of the suspects are from Windsor.
